14:42.14pancakeafaik the kernel hangs after jumping to the kernel entry point
14:42.55pancake(from haret) i read that you're using irda to show the printk messages
14:43.08pancakehow can I do that?
14:43.47Kevin2Do you have an irda dongle on your host?
14:44.23pancakeyup, several ones on different boxes and gadgets
14:46.01Kevin2Well, if you have a simple serial one, it may be easier for you - just line up the phone and your irda dongle and "cat" the serial port for you host dongle.
14:46.27pancakei need any patch for the kernel or just some change the default.txt?
14:46.29Kevin2I have a usb dongle and had to go a bit further to get at the info.  I installed the "systemtap" utility and then ran:
14:47.01Kevin2Eek - don't have the command anymore..
14:47.21pancakeoops
14:47.40Kevin2pancake: The default hermes kernel should early boot messages on.
14:48.02pancakedirectly via irda?
14:48.05Kevin2You can enable more by turning on serial console and by enabling CONFIG_DEBUG_LL (which is in the "kernel hacking" menu).
14:49.06pancakeok
14:50.13Kevin2The command was something like:  stap -v -e 'probe module("irda*").function("async_unwrap_char") { printf("%d\n", $byte) }'
14:50.57Kevin2Oh yeah, you need to turn on "enable incoming beams" on the hermes in wince.
14:50.58pancakeuhm, it's not in portage..will look for it, seems interesting
14:51.17pancakesadeness: have phun
14:51.45Kevin2you should probably verify the irda stuff is running by launching "irdadump" on your host.
